Tom Wandell Assigned to Texas for Conditioning

Wandell has been bothered by a shoulder injury this preseason, and Dallas decided he'd be better off taking a conditioning stint in Texas. He's expected to play in tomorrow's game against Houston. Here's the release from Dallas:
The Dallas Stars announced today that the club has assigned center Tom Wandell to the Texas Stars of the American Hockey League (AHL) for conditioning. He is scheduled to play in Sunday's pre-season game at Cedar Park Center when Texas hosts the Houston Aeros (5:00 pm CT).

Wandell, 23, has not appeared in a Dallas Stars pre-season game this year due to a shoulder injury. He appeared in 50 games for Dallas last season, scoring 5 goals and 10 assists for 15 points. Wandell's season was cut shot with a torn ACL injury on Jan. 21 at Vancouver.

Wandell was Dallas' fifth round selection (146th overall) in the 2005 NHL Entry Draft.
